Trade Compliance Environment III - IIEI-216
Course Description: This three-week overview course is a continuation of the examination of the trade compliance environment begun in IIEI-214. It is intended for new, entry-level personnel who need to gain a basic level of understanding of specific ITAR topics in the US trade compliance environment, including Denied Entities Screening, Foreign National issues and the need for auditing export compliance process and procedures. Students seeking an in-depth understanding of these topics should enroll in advanced (300-level) courses that deal with these topics.
Prerequisite: Trade Compliance Environment I (IIEI-214), Trade Compliance Environment II (IIEI-215)
Course Credit: 1.5 Credit Hours
Major Course Topics & Course Outcomes
As a result of the group and individual activities included in this course, the student will acquire the following knowledge and skills that can be applied to the workplace:
Denied Entities Screening Processes
- Understand the basis and practice of performing Denied Entities screenings
- Know how to use a checking process for using the Debarred Parties lists
Foreign National (FN)
- Comprehend the definition of a Foreign National / RFI (Representative of Foreign Interest).
- Know the licensing requirements for a FN / RFI under ITAR.
- Understand the risks associated with a FN as related to technology transfers.
- Know the critical issues related to having a FN as an employee under the ITAR.
Auditing Export Compliance Processes & Procedures under the ITAR
- Possess basic knowledge of US Government suggested best
practices for auditing export compliance processes and procedures.
- Understand the importance of self-auditing of export licenses and transactions for compliance with the regulations and procedures.
Record Keeping
- Demonstrate knowledge of ITAR record keeping and reporting concepts.
- Know the ITAR recordkeeping and reporting requirements.
